About Marine Insurance Law in Ipoh, Malaysia

Marine insurance is a specialized field of law that deals with the protection against risks and losses associated with maritime activities. In Ipoh, Malaysia, marine insurance covers a range of areas such as cargo insurance, hull insurance, and liability insurance. The city, being in a region contributing significantly to Malaysia's maritime activities, necessitates understanding the nuances of marine insurance to protect one’s maritime interests effectively.

Local Laws Overview

Ipoh, Malaysia adheres to various national maritime laws alongside international conventions that Malaysia is a party to. The Marine Insurance Act 1906 forms the backbone of marine insurance law in Malaysia, laying out guidelines for contracts and claim processes. Additionally, Malaysian case law, precedents, and local regulations also play a significant role in shaping the intricacies of marine insurance claims and disputes resolution in Ipoh.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is covered under marine insurance?

Marine insurance typically covers loss or damage to ships, cargo, terminals, and any transport used to transfer property among different points of origin and final destination.

How is marine insurance premium calculated in Malaysia?

Premiums are calculated based on factors such as the type of cargo, route, duration of the voyage, and the vessel's condition, alongside other risk factors.

What should I do if my marine insurance claim is denied?

If your claim is denied, consult with a marine insurance lawyer to review the denial reasons and explore the possibility of challenging it or renegotiating terms with your insurer.

Is legal assistance necessary for marine insurance cases?

While not mandatory, having a lawyer can be highly beneficial in navigating the complexities of marine insurance policies and claim procedures, ensuring proper compliance and representation.

What is a warranty in marine insurance?

A warranty is a promise in an insurance policy that certain conditions will be met. Breach of warranty can void the insurance policy.

When is a claim for general average made?

A claim for general average is made when there is a common loss, and voluntary sacrifice is made for the safety of all involved in the maritime venture, requiring all parties to share the loss proportionally.

What is the difference between hull insurance and cargo insurance?

Hull insurance covers the vessel against damages, whereas cargo insurance covers the goods or cargo being transported.

How does the Marine Insurance Act 1906 affect policyholders in Malaysia?

The Marine Insurance Act 1906 provides a comprehensive framework for marine insurance contracts, affecting definitions, warranties, indemnities, and claim procedures in Malaysia.

Which international conventions influence marine insurance in Malaysia?

Conventions such as the International Convention for the Safety of Life at Sea (SOLAS) and the International Convention on Salvage have significant bearings on Malaysia's marine insurance landscape.

Can marine insurance be customized for specific needs?

Yes, policies can often be tailored to address specific needs, allowing for particular routes, durations, and types of cargo to be covered as per the insured's requirements.
